Portál AbcLinuxu, 12. května 2025 11:23
TC="/shaper/tc" IPR="/shaper/ip" INET="eth0" ILOC="eth1" ADDC="$TC class add dev" ADDQ="$TC qdisc add dev" ADDF="$TC filter add dev" IFB0="ifb0" ip link set dev $IFB0 down 2>/dev/null $TC qdisc del dev $IFB0 root 2>/dev/null # nahodime virtualni rozhrani modprobe ifb numifbs=1 2>/dev/null ip link set dev $IFB0 up 2>/dev/null $TC qdisc del dev $ILOC ingress 2>/dev/null $TC qdisc add dev $ILOC ingress 2>/dev/null # presmerujeme prichozi traffic (ten co prijde na $ILOC smer do netu - u vas misto $ILOC to br0[nevim jestli to muze fungovat na moste]) do $IFB0 a na nej uz muzeme povesit qdisc jak je "ukazka" dole $TC filter add dev $ILOC parent ffff: protocol ip u32 match u32 0 0 flowid 1:1 action mirred egress redirect dev $IFB0 # "ukazka" - a takto uz normalne muzeme omezovat na $IFB0 jako to delate na tom br0, date filtry a omezujete $ADDQ $IFB0 root handle 1:0 htb default 13 $ADDC $IFB0 parent 1:0 classid 1:1 htb rate 6830kbit
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.